***3 1/2 stars*** The Kingdom of Sussex has become very difficult to access due to the sinkhole debacle, so in an effort to remain friends with my top-tier chum resident of said Kingdom in these perilous times, we decided to have lunch on the other side of Sussex, far far away from my typical Route 80/15 entry point. Sussex overall isn't the best area for eating options unfortunately, with the exception of a very small handful of establishments, so we knew the risks going in. This was actually a little better than I was expecting but there were a few misses. We came here (along with my #1 Honorary Young Pup Chum) yesterday for an earlyish lunch around noon on a dreary Saturday. It looks like they have decent outdoor seating in the back, but that was definitely not an option on this day. We were seated in their main dining area (my chum noted there's a downstairs bar area she's never been in herself, but I'd be curious about that), which was smaller than the pictures online would suggest - not cramped but not quite as homey/comfortable as I was expecting. I did love their little ice bin/cabinet by the front where they keep their bottles of water cold for each table; cute touch. We impulsively decided to hit up the Berry Mule option on the Specials Menu, and that was a huge highlight - one of the better mules either of us has had in recent memory, and we're optimistic that it officially got my chum out of her year-long mule slump (which is a thing, people. I've witnessed it firsthand). The mulled berries in the bottom were a little annoying, especially with the tiny mixing straws where the fruit kept getting caught on the bottom, but overall very refreshing and tasty. I'd ask for a normal straw or swig straight up to avoid our berry drama in the future. The mozzy sticks were pretty legit as well. A little TOO overly fried for my taste but still a positive (I like it when they have a bit more give to them, if that makes sense) and the accompanying marinara sauce was decent. Top marks from all participants. I decided to aggressively assert myself at the top of the food chain on this particular day and went with the Butter & Rosemary Roasted Ribeye. Eh. The bacon potato cream sauce it comes with is really good but there are two issues - one, it's completely obscuring the steak, so you can't see the super fatty gristle sections that I'd typically avoid/cut off and you aren't going to discover them until it's too late and they're in your mouth and two, the sauce got cold very quickly. It was a little nippy in there (my chum noted that the waitress had to turn up the heat in there about halfway through our meal) but I think the obvious fix is to make sure that sauce is piping hot to begin with so it's not chilly within two minutes. The potatoes were excellent, both in mashed and presumably roasted form. Would get those again in a heartbeat. Somehow I still found room for dessert and opted for the mint chip brownie sundae. I'm pretty sure all of the ice cream here is actually gelato, so be aware you're getting a rich co-star with these desserts. It was very good though on all fronts, and I thought the brownie was just the right amount of density - this was the only item I had, now that I'm thinking about it, that didn't have any slight issues. Perfect across the board as far as I'm concerned. The service was excellent and put this over the top for me as a result. Our waitress was very friendly and down-to-earth, came by regularly, and demonstrated a very strong knowledge of the menu. We were all huge fans, so even with small problems across most of the items served, that intangible made up for a lot in my book. I might have to get a little creative to avoid some metaphorical potholes (or dare I say sinkholes) on the menu but this is worth a repeat visit.
